On Nov. 30, 2010, Tufts University announced that Anthony P. Monaco, who currently serves as pro-vice-chancellor for planning and resources at the University of Oxford, will assume office as the thirteenth President of Tufts University next summer.
Jim Stern, chairman of the Board of Trustees, introduced President-elect Monaco live from the Coolidge Room in Ballou Hall on the Medford/ Somerville campus. The event was webcast live.
